如何解决mysql的Table is read only错误
mysql的Table xxxx is read only错误往往是发生在Linux主机上,在网上查了很多资料后终于发现它本质上是个权限问题。
要解决它首先要给mysql的数据库目录加上可写权限,即777
然后到mysql的Bin目录执行刷新
mysqladmin -u <username> -p flush-tables
并且保证mysql安装目录的/var/lib/mysql的目录权限设置为700
其间所有文件的权限设置为660
基本可以解决
另:当我们更改了mysql权限表,我们可以重起服务器,但更简单的办法是执行
mysqladmin -u <username> -p reload
本文介绍了如何解决MySQL中出现的Tableisreadonly错误。主要步骤包括调整数据库目录权限至777,执行mysqladmin命令刷新表,并确保安装目录权限正确设置。通过这些步骤通常能够有效解决问题。


被折叠的 条评论
为什么被折叠?



